Jack K8ZOA and I were friends for a long time. Back to the days in the
mid-late 1960's when we were in EE studies at Wayne State University the same
time. We were lab partners in most every undergraduate EE course that had a
lab. That branched out to a personal friendship that lasted a long while.
Jack was a brilliant student and engineer. Anyone who had contact with him
will say the exact same thing. He always had something going on technically
and he was fun to learn from.
After our BSEE days, Jack worked for the FCC (Detroit office) for a bit,
then got his MSEE and eventually his LLD. We lost touch with eachother during
most of his lawyer years but reacquainted when he retired and began
Clifton Laboratories. I am happy that DX Engineering will continue to offer his
fine products
We even collaborated on a final project, about three years ago, when he
asked me to help him gather old photos from our classmates, depicting the days
at WSU, and put an album together. Fun stuff.
RIP Jack!

On Wednesday K8ZOA, Jack R. Smith, passed away from liver, kidney and
respiratory complications. He was both a lawyer and engineer working
for both the FCC and private practice law firms. Jack was an inventor
and created Clifton Laboratories. Earlier this month DX Engineering
purchased Clifton Laboratories and plans to continue manufacturing
those "products in the exact same fashion and service Jack did", says
K3LR, Tim Duffy, Chief Operating Officer of DX Engineering.
